Best Time to Visit Turkey - When is the best time to Travel to Turkey?
With a Mediterranean climate, beautiful beaches, skiing slopes, nature reserves and so much else on offer, the best time to visit Turkey depends on what you plan to do. Generally speaking, if you had to ask when is the best time to travel to Turkey, locals would tell you that spring (April to June) is the best season to visit – the weather is warm with long days and little rain, and this is one of the quieter times from a tourist perspective, meaning you get a chance to explore without worrying about crowded tourist attractions or packed beaches.
After spring, the next best time to visit is in autumn (mid-September to late October). Weather is mild with a little rain. Summer (mid-June to September) is the hottest month, and also the busiest tourist season – there is little or no rain, and while weather inland may be cooler, along the coast it is perfect for beaches, swimming and other water-based activities. Winter (November to March) is cold, and the quietest tourist month – skiing and other wintersports are popular activities during this season.
